
Kitchen tips: Chakla-sellers are an important part of the kitchen, and according to many traditions they also have religious significance. Especially in Hindu beliefs, it has been said that Chakla-Balal should be kept clean because it is connected to mother Annapurna, and Lakshmi resides in a clean kitchen. But many times the dough sticks on the chakla or cylinder and does not withdraw from normal washing, then you can easily clean them by adopting some easy remedies given below.

Use hot water: First of all, soak the chakla and cylinder in warm water for some time. This will soften the dough and then easily descend when rubbing with scrubber or an old cloth.

Lemon and salt: Put a little salt on half a lemon and rub it on the chain. This will not only remove the sticky dough, but will also eliminate any kind of smell or bacteria.
Vinegar and Baking Soda: Add 1 teaspoon of baking soda and 1-2 tablespoons white vinegar to a bowl. Apply this mixture on the chakla or cylinder and leave for 10 minutes. Then clean with a scrubber, the dough will leave immediately.
Use old brush: If the surface of the chakla is rough (such as wood), then the remaining pieces of flour can be cleaned by rubbing the old toothbrush.
Dry flour or flour bran: Sometimes it is easily removed by rubbing on the flour sticking with dry flour.
Additional suggestions (Kitchen tips)
1- After cooking, immediately clean the chakla-selle, so that the dough does not dry.
2- Deep cleaning with lemon, vinegar or salt at least once a week.
3- Do not keep the wooden chakle-selle in water for long, it can swell wood.
